  6. UPPER SENEGAL & NIGER, Foreign Office Handbook, HMSO 1920

    UPPER SENEGAL and NIGER. One in series of handbooks originally prepared for delegates at the Paris Peace Conference at the end of the First World War and issued for use by the public in 1920. Each handbook contains information on its subject's history, geography, economics, communications, etc.
